Top 10 Huts and Cabins around Sandbostel

Best huts around Sandbostel offer various resting points for outdoor enthusiasts. The region features a mix of natural landscapes and designated shelters, providing opportunities for breaks during walks or bike rides. These structures are designed to offer respite and facilities in different settings, from forests to canal-side locations. They serve as practical stops for those exploring the area's trails.

Best huts around Sandbostel

  • The most popular huts is Köte rest hut in the moor, a hut that provides a weather-independent rest area. This unique structure, resembling a kote, offers a large round bench and table inside, suitable for groups.
  • Another must-see spot is Seehürnsbarg Lake, a lake with an associated hut and viewpoint. It is noted as a great place for a break, with a small hut located near the Nordpfade Weg.
  • Visitors also love Tinster Holz Shelter, a rest area in the middle of Tinster wood. This shelter provides a good place to take a break, offering information on an orientation board and storage for bicycles.
  • Sandbostel is known for its diverse range of shelters, including forest huts, rest huts in moorlands, and shelters by canals. These structures vary from simple weather shelters to more elaborate huts with facilities.

Köte rest hut in the moor

Highlight • Mountain Hut

A resting place in the form of a kote, as is very common in the Harz region. However, not completely made of wood like in the resin, but with tarpaulins and trunks. Very suitable as a weather-independent rest area.

Tinster Holz Shelter

Highlight • Mountain Hut

Very nice rest area in the middle of Tinster wood. Here you can decide where to go next. Good storage for bicycles. Information on an orientation board. Get air ... and then it goes on

Are there any historical sites or significant 'huts' to visit in Sandbostel?

While the huts mentioned in this guide are recreational shelters, Sandbostel is historically significant for the Sandbostel Camp Memorial. This site preserves original structures, including wooden dormitory huts, a latrine, and a kitchen building, from the former Stalag X B prisoner-of-war and concentration camp. These historical 'huts' offer a profound insight into a grim chapter of human history and serve as a vital educational center. Can I find facilities like toilets or barbecue areas at these huts?

Some huts and rest areas around Sandbostel do offer facilities. The Köte rest hut in the moor provides a large table, and the Tinster Holz Shelter offers bicycle storage and an information board. The Forest Hut and Barbecue Area explicitly mentions seating and a barbecue area, though the hut itself and an outhouse might be locked depending on the season. The Rest area with shelter at the Oste-Hamme Canal also has an information board.
